Lifetime prediction is a research field and methodological approach focused on estimating the duration of functional life for systems, components, materials, or natural phenomena. It involves investigating and modeling the factors and processes that lead to degradation, failure, or cessation of existence, such as operational stresses, environmental conditions, and intrinsic properties. This analysis provides forecasts critical for ensuring reliability, optimizing operational planning, and understanding temporal dynamics in diverse fields, ranging from the operational lifespan of engineered systems like nuclear reactors to the evolutionary timescales of astrophysical objects like stars.
